i gotta lot of questions about these values!!

-I think Poehling for Bortuzzo works in a vacuum, value-wise, but I don't know who St. Louis brings up to play RD3 if they trade Bortuzzo - which makes him more valuable to them than another 4C like Poehling.

-I don't see anything in this that makes sense for Toronto - you're giving them a mild upgrade from Gaudette to Archibald, I guess, and Ruhwedel is an affordable depth D, but I think Kerfoot to McGinn is a major downgrade for them - both in terms of the player, and in terms of term - I don't think they want to save that $750K enough to sign on for 2 more years of McGinn.

-Wow! This is terrible for Vancouver - Petry probably doesn't waive to go back into Canada, first off, but even then I don't see the value here. Garland is a strong middle-6 wing, Hoglander is already a solid middle-6er at 21 with more upside than Kapanen, and Vancouver doesn't need to move the last year of Ferland's LTIR contract. I would also question the wisdom of Vancouver trading youth for veterans when their team has looked a little less than playoff-ready so far this year.

-Nothing here for CBJ to make the deal. Blueger is a bottom-6 guy, Maniscalco is playing in the ECHL, and a 5th isn't enough for a guy who's probably their 2nd-best Dman currently. If they want to sell him off in his UFA year, they could easily top the Ben Chiarot package from last year (1st/3rd/solid prospect) - maybe even more based on his age and their ability to retain him down to $1.4M.

-Now this trade is an extreme tilt back the other way - why would you give up Dumo *and* a decent prospect in Hallander to get back a 7th D like Beaulieu? If you need to move Dumoulin's cap, I'm sure you can find a taker for his deal - at the very least, the team you've built right here has the cap space where you could fully retain him down and send him to some team at $2.05M and get *something* back, instead of sacrificing a prospect to get back a warm body.

-I'm not sure how I feel on this one - I don't think it makes sense to trade Legare for a guy that you're just going to stick on the 4th line; but I don't think there's enough here for Chicago to retain $2.5M this year and next. Both sides probably decline this one.
